Tom Clancy’s Guitar Band Revolution: Ubisoft seeks designer for new music game

Recommended Videos

So apparently, music games are popular. I didn’t notice, but maybe Ubisoft did. 

The developer’s San Francisco-based offices are seeking a lead designer to “help guide the creation of an exciting new cross-platform music based game.” The job listing, found on Gamasutra, is very specific about seeking a “highly talented, motivated and experienced person.” So the folks who worked on the Hannah Montana plug-n-play guitar game need not apply.

When they say “cross-platform,” they’re not kidding — the listing specifically mentions PlayStation 3, Xbox 360, and Wii among the platforms.

Considering Ubisoft’s long history with the “Imagine” series of games, it’s not unlikely that we’ll eventually see Babyz versus Poniez: Pop Superstar Edition. But with PS3 and Xbox 360 on the development docket, maybe Ubisoft has something a bit more interesting in mind.
